Difference Between Verification And Validation In Software Testing Verification and validation are two crucial, yet distinct, processes in software testing. think of it like building a house: verification ensures you’re building the house correctly according to the blueprints, while validation ensures you’re building the right house that meets the client’s needs. Explain the difference between verification and validation. verification and validation are distinct but related processes in software development, both crucial for ensuring software quality. Difference between verification and validation: verification is static testing where as validations is dynamic testing. verification takes place before validation. verification evaluates plans, document, requirements and specification, where as validation evaluates product.
